How to make Loaded Green Bean Casserole with Cheese and Bacon

You can jump to the recipe card for full ingredients & instructions!

  1. Blanch the green beans and place into iced water.
  2. Whisk together the soup, milk and seasonings and whisk in the cheese.
  3. Pour over the green beans and transfer to a casserole dish.
  4. Top with cheese and bake.
  5. Top with bacon pieces and fried onions and cook til browned.

Can you make green bean casserole ahead of time?

Yes! This is a great make ahead dish. You can make up the sauce and add to the casserole with the beans, then cover and keep refrigerated for up to 2 days. When ready, top with cheese and bake as per the recipe.

How long does green bean casserole keep?

If you have leftovers, they will keep well in the fridge for up to 4 days. The onions will soften a little, but it will still be good to eat. Reheat it in the oven at 350F for 10 to 15 minutes to warm through.

Can you make green bean casserole with frozen beans?

Yes! Frozen beans work great with this recipe. Blanch them as you would fresh, just for an additional minute til tender.

Can you make casserole with canned green beans?

If you prefer, canned green beans can also be used in this casserole. There’s no need to blanch them, just mix them with the mushroom soup mix and pour into the dish to bake.

Tips!

  • Placing the cooked green beans into iced water helps the to keep their texture and not lose their bright green color. This process is known as blanching.
  • If you don’t like mushrooms, you can make this with cream of chicken soup as well.
  • Trim the ends off of the green beans before cooking as these can be tough to eat.

Ingredients

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F. Spray a 1-quart casserole dish with cooking spray and set aside.

    Loaded Green Bean Casserole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(14)

  • In a large pot of boiling water, add the green beans and cook for 3 minutes, until bright green. Drain, then place in an ice bath to cool. Transfer to a large bowl and set aside.

    1 pound green beans

    Loaded Green Bean Casserole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(15)

  • Meanwhile, in a saucepan set over medium heat, whisk together the soup, milk,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, and pepper. Bring the mixture to a simmer, then whisk in 1 cup of the cheese until completely incorporated. Pour over the green beans and toss to coat, then transfer to a casserole dish.

    10.5 ounces condensed Cream of Mushroom soup, 1 cup milk, 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ce, 1 teaspoon garlic powder, 1 teaspoon ground black pepper, 2 cups freshly shredded cheddar cheese

    Loaded Green Bean Casserole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(16)

  • Top with remaining cheese, then bake for 20 minutes, until warmed through and bubbling around the edges.

    2 cups freshly shredded cheddar cheese

    Loaded Green Bean Casserole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(17)

  • Top the casserole with fried onions and the crisp bacon and bake for an additional 5 minutes.

    1½ cups french fried onions, 4 slices crumbled cooked bacon
